There has been a number of the sinking due to liquefaction of bulk cargoes in recent years. International dry bulk ship owners association (INTERCARGO) have repeatedly warned the risk of liquefaction, and strengthen the testing and verification of the transport conditions of iron ore powder and nickel ore by IMO. However, when the moisture content of mineral powder and other solid bulk cargoes below the TML, ship may also heel seriously, even capsize due to liquefaction of cargoes; when the moisture content of mineral powder and other solid bulk cargoes above the TML, ship may also arrive the destination safely. Therefore, it is necessary to identify the basic concepts of liquefaction of bulk cargoes, in-depth study of the liquefaction mechanism of cargoes, and provide theoretical guidance for transportation.This paper expounds the liquefaction mechanism of the cargoes which may liquefy from the perspective of Soil mechanics. By studying the reasons and the definition of soil liquefaction, the second chapter gives the reasons and the definition of liquefaction of cargoes which may liquefy, and analyzes the influence factors such as soil particle size effects on soil liquefaction. In addition, through studying the relationship between the water content and the shear strength of soil, using the changing rule of the soil shear strength curve with water content, reclassify the mineral powders in the IMSBC rules.The third chapter analyzes the liquefaction degree of the cargoes which may liquefy, puts forward the concept of degree of liquefaction, and establishes the function relation between the angle of repose of liquefied cargo and liquefaction degree. In addition, the third chapter also studies and defines the liquefaction velocity of the cargo, and expounds the influence of the liquefaction velocity to ship. Finally, analyzation is made on actual cases to prove the liquefaction mechanism and proposed definitions.The study contents and conclusions of this paper provides a beneficial reference for shipping of cargoes which may liquefy, offers a practical and effective guidance to cargoes such as mineral powders, reduces the risk of transportation of liquefying cargo by sea, and ensures safety of personnel, cargoes, and the marine environment.
